(2011) : Gender Issues In: Hauser, Stuart T.; Prinstein, Mitchell J. (Hg.): Encyclopedia of Adolescence: Burlington: Elsevier Science, S. 151-159
Abstract: Gender is an important social category that affects adolescents' lives in multiple ways. Gender identities and gender schemas shape the kinds of ideas and behaviors that adolescents may consider appropriate for themselves and others. Stereotyped beliefs may lead to sexism, including prejudiced attitudes and discriminatory behaviors. Gender-related variations during adolescence occur in academic achievement, athletic participation, sexuality, body image, dating relationships, friendship intimacy, and aggression.
